What $169,500 Buys You in DC: 327 Square Feet
In this week’s installment of What X Buys You, we look at the $169,500 price point and find a studio apartment in the gray area neighborhood that some consider Logan Circle and others the U Street Corridor. This unit measures out at 327 square feet, small by most people’s standards, but as you can see from the photos the current owner has done a nice job with the space, and the windows offer a ton of natural light. Looking at the sales history for the unit, it also seems like quite a deal. Sold for $215,000 in 2005, the unit is now on the market at almost a 25 percent discount. More details and photos below.
- Address: 1822 15th Street NW, #1 (map)
- Price: $169,500
- Bedrooms: 0
- Bathrooms: One
- Square Footage: 327
